OU linebacker Mike Balogun won't play against BYU, his attorney says
NORMAN — Oklahoma middle linebacker Mike Balogun won’t play against Brigham Young this weekend as he continues his fight with the NCAA, his attorney, Woody Glass, told The Oklahoman Monday afternoon.

“Mike will not be able to make the trip,” Glass said in an e-mail.
The NCAA is currently deliberating on whether to recertify Balogun’s eligibility. Balogun was decertified earlier this month after the NCAA suspected he participated in semi-pro football after his 21st birthday. Balogun’s attorney was hoping the NCAA would expedite the process and make a determination before Saturday.
With Balogun out, sophomore Austin Box will back up starter Ryan Reynolds at middle linebacker.
